single_key - [mainnet]
This module implements Single Key representations of public keys. It is used to represent public keys for the Ed25519, SECP256K1, WebAuthn, and Keyless schemes in a unified way.
use 0x1::bcs;use 0x1::bcs_stream;use 0x1::ed25519;use 0x1::error;use 0x1::federated_keyless;use 0x1::hash;use 0x1::keyless;use 0x1::secp256k1;use 0x1::secp256r1;

Constants
The identifier of the Single Key signature scheme, which is used when deriving Aptos authentication keys by hashing it together with an Single Key public key.
const SIGNATURE_SCHEME_ID: u8 = 2;
Scheme identifier for Ed25519 single keys.
const ED25519_PUBLIC_KEY_TYPE: u8 = 0;
Unrecognized public key type.
const E_INVALID_PUBLIC_KEY_TYPE: u64 = 1;
There are extra bytes in the input when deserializing a Single Key public key.
const E_INVALID_SINGLE_KEY_EXTRA_BYTES: u64 = 2;
Scheme identifier for Federated Keyless single keys.
const FEDERATED_KEYLESS_PUBLIC_KEY_TYPE: u8 = 4;
Scheme identifier for Keyless single keys.
const KEYLESS_PUBLIC_KEY_TYPE: u8 = 3;
Scheme identifier for SECP256K1 single keys.
const SECP256K1_PUBLIC_KEY_TYPE: u8 = 1;
Scheme identifier for WebAuthn single keys.
const WEB_AUTHN_PUBLIC_KEY_TYPE: u8 = 2;
Functions
new_public_key_from_bytes
Parses the input bytes as a AnyPublicKey. The public key bytes are not guaranteed to be a valid representation of a point on its corresponding curve if applicable. It does check that the bytes deserialize into a well-formed public key for the given scheme.
public fun new_public_key_from_bytes(bytes: vector<u8>): single_key::AnyPublicKey
Implementation
public fun new_public_key_from_bytes(bytes: vector<u8>): AnyPublicKey { let stream = bcs_stream::new(bytes); let pk = deserialize_any_public_key(&mut stream); assert!(!bcs_stream::has_remaining(&mut stream), error::invalid_argument(E_INVALID_SINGLE_KEY_EXTRA_BYTES)); pk}
deserialize_any_public_key
Deserializes a Single Key public key from a BCS stream.
public fun deserialize_any_public_key(stream: &mut bcs_stream::BCSStream): single_key::AnyPublicKey
Implementation
public fun deserialize_any_public_key(stream: &mut bcs_stream::BCSStream): AnyPublicKey { let scheme_id = bcs_stream::deserialize_u8(stream); let pk: AnyPublicKey; if (scheme_id == ED25519_PUBLIC_KEY_TYPE) { let public_key_bytes = bcs_stream::deserialize_vector(stream, |x| deserialize_u8(x)); pk = AnyPublicKey::Ed25519{pk: ed25519::new_unvalidated_public_key_from_bytes(public_key_bytes)} } else if (scheme_id == SECP256K1_PUBLIC_KEY_TYPE) { let public_key_bytes = bcs_stream::deserialize_vector(stream, |x| deserialize_u8(x)); pk = AnyPublicKey::Secp256k1Ecdsa{pk: secp256k1::ecdsa_raw_public_key_from_64_bytes(public_key_bytes)}; } else if (scheme_id == WEB_AUTHN_PUBLIC_KEY_TYPE) { let public_key_bytes = bcs_stream::deserialize_vector(stream, |x| deserialize_u8(x)); pk = AnyPublicKey::Secp256r1Ecdsa{pk: secp256r1::ecdsa_raw_public_key_from_64_bytes(public_key_bytes)}; } else if (scheme_id == KEYLESS_PUBLIC_KEY_TYPE) { pk = AnyPublicKey::Keyless{pk: keyless::deserialize_public_key(stream)}; } else if (scheme_id == FEDERATED_KEYLESS_PUBLIC_KEY_TYPE) { pk = AnyPublicKey::FederatedKeyless{pk: federated_keyless::deserialize_public_key(stream)} } else { abort error::invalid_argument(E_INVALID_PUBLIC_KEY_TYPE); }; pk}
is_keyless_or_federated_keyless_public_key
Returns true if the public key is a keyless or federated keyless public key.
public fun is_keyless_or_federated_keyless_public_key(pk: &single_key::AnyPublicKey): bool
Implementation
public fun is_keyless_or_federated_keyless_public_key(pk: &AnyPublicKey): bool { match (pk) { AnyPublicKey::Keyless { .. } => true, AnyPublicKey::FederatedKeyless { .. } => true, _ => false }}
from_ed25519_public_key_unvalidated
Converts an unvalidated Ed25519 public key to an AnyPublicKey.
public fun from_ed25519_public_key_unvalidated(pk: ed25519::UnvalidatedPublicKey): single_key::AnyPublicKey
Implementation
public fun from_ed25519_public_key_unvalidated(pk: ed25519::UnvalidatedPublicKey): AnyPublicKey { AnyPublicKey::Ed25519 { pk }}
to_authentication_key
Gets the authentication key for the AnyPublicKey.
public fun to_authentication_key(self: &single_key::AnyPublicKey): vector<u8>
Implementation
public fun to_authentication_key(self: &AnyPublicKey): vector<u8> { let pk_bytes = bcs::to_bytes(self); pk_bytes.push_back(SIGNATURE_SCHEME_ID); hash::sha3_256(pk_bytes)}
